015343 Programming for Diabetes Education
6cp
Requisite(s): 015342 Teaching and Learning in Diabetes Education
Postgraduate
Subject coordinator: Jane Sampson
This subject aims to help students develop their understanding of the theory and practice related to developing, implementing, supporting and evaluating a variety of diabetes education programs in response to the needs, demands, capabilities and interests of diabetes education clients and providers.
